Kirkcaldy pays last respects to veteran Jimmy Sinclair

The people of Kirkcaldy turned out to pay their final respects to Jimmy Sinclair, the Kirkcaldy WW2 veteran who passed away last week aged 107.

While the lockdown restricted many from attending the funeral itself, a number of people arrived at Kirkcaldy Town Square and observed social distancing rules as the hearse drew up to the town house.The Last Post was played as a those who had gathered remembered Jimmy.

The hearse then made its way up to Kirkcaldy Crematorium, with many friends and wellwishers stood along the route, many holding Saltires, flags or banners in memory of Jimmy, who was a staunch believer in Scottish Independence.

While it was undoubtedly a sad loss for everyone, the mood remained relatively jovial in celebration of Jimmy’s life.
